在患有炎症性肠病的患者中,基于机器学习的纵向医疗保健利用的表征

机器学习模型可以识别炎症性肠病 (IBD) 的高医疗保健资源用户. 这些模型准确地预测了未来的使用情况,有助于更好地分配资源和协调患者护理.

背景情况:
- 炎症性肠病 (IBD) 与高医疗利用率有关.
- 预测高资源用户可以优化资源配置.
- 开发模型来预测患者需求对于高效的医疗保健管理至关重要.
研究的目的:
- 开发机器学习模型,根据临床利用模式对IBD患者进行分类.
- 根据基线临床数据预测纵向医疗保健利用率.
- 加强IBD护理中的资源配置和患者风险评估.
主要方法:
- 在两个学术中心对1174名IBD成年患者 (2015-2021) 的回顾性研究.
- 利用机器学习进行患者聚类和预测医疗保健利用情况.
- 将模型性能与顺序回归和随机选择方法进行比较.
主要成果:
- 聚类确定了不同的低,中,高资源利用群体.
- 机器学习模型预测了81%-85%的准确度 (AUC 0.84-0.90) 的纵向医疗保健利用率.
- 与传统方法相比,模型表现出优越的预测性能.
结论:
- 机器学习通过资源利用有效地将IBD患者聚集在一起.
- 使用基线临床因素,可以准确预测纵向利用率.
- 整合到电子健康记录中可以支持风险评估,护理协调和资源分配.

Inflammatory Bowel Disease II: Crohn's Disease
Inflammatory bowel disease, commonly known as IBD, refers to a collection of disorders that lead to persistent inflammation of the gastrointestinal tract. The two types of IBD are ulcerative colitis, which impacts the colon, and Crohn's disease, which can involve any part of the gastrointestinal segment.
